As used in this article, the following terms shall have the meanings indicated:
BASEMENTA story partly underground but having at least 1/2 its height, measured from finished floor to finished ceiling, above the curb level at the center of the street front.
CELLARA story having more than 1/2 its height, measured from finished floor to finished ceiling, below the curb level at the center of the street front.
GROUND FLOOR AREAThe area within the exterior of the walls of the building at grade level, excluding attached garages, unenclosed porches or breezeways but including incorporated garages with livable floor area above them.
LIVABLE FLOOR AREAThe aggregate area of all floors included within the outer walls of a building, excluding basements, cellars, rooms for heating equipment, garages, unenclosed porches, unfinished attics and storerooms and other unheated areas and including only such floor area under a sloping ceiling for which the headroom is not less than five feet, and then only if at least 60% of such floor has a ceiling height of not less than seven feet six inches and if any such floor that is situated above another story has access to the floor below by a permanent built-in stairway. However, 1/2 of the floor area of completely finished and heated rooms in a basement may be included in the aggregate area.
